What Is Google PageRank?

Drive Traffic to Your Web Site, Search Engine Traffic

First conceived by Google Cofounder Larry Page during his days at Stanford University, PageRank is a critical piece of Google’s success story. Google was able to return higher quality search results by adding PageRank to other, existing criteria such as keyword relevancy to gain the competitive edge it needed to propel itself to the top of the search industry. continue »

Use a Blog to Drive Traffic to Your Site

Blog, Drive Traffic to Your Web Site

More people than ever are reading blogs. According to a 2007 eMarketer study, 94 million people— half of all Internet users — read at least one blog post a month. The company forecasts that 105 million people will read at least one blog post per month in 2008, and by 2012, that number will jump to 145 million people, or 67 percent of all Internet users. continue »

Using Keywords to Boost Search Engine Visibility

Blog, Drive Traffic to Your Web Site

If your blog is part of your Web site and optimized with relevant keywords, it can help your site rank higher in search engines. Remember that the most important goal of your blog is to create interesting content. Artificially inserting keywords will turn readers away, and you might be penalized by search engines. So write as you would speak, and fit your keywords in naturally. continue »
